KN52 HBJ is a 2002 Mcc Smart Pulse Softouch Auto in Black with a 599c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 63.6%.
Across all 2002 Mcc Smart Pulse Softouch Auto models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.7% with a typical mileage of 51,128 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Mcc Smart Pulse Softouch Auto fails its MOT is stop lamp not working, accounting for 162 recorded failures. If you're considering buying KN52 HBJ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Mcc Smart Pulse Softouch Auto typ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 24 years old, this Mcc Smart Pulse Softouch Auto is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
